Transaction c6bd628dc88822a514badf9cc4a7b1398c91f6d2c594657b5b45415303be1668
1 Input
1 Output
-
c6bd628dc88822a514badf9cc4a7b1398c91f6d2c594657b5b45415303be1668:0
- value
- 2920762
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1eb33424e506f5c298c0dab28ef68325804fbf6 OP_EQUAL
- address
- 3HumHVjdWegP3TkkX7fWiRMwpSrW2Y9Vep